Topeka, KS — GO Topeka is excited to announce that 18 local businesses have been named finalists for recognition at Topeka and Shawnee County’s 44th annual Small Business Awards.
Covering six different categories, the 2025 Small Business Awards, organized by GO Topeka and the Greater Topeka Partnership, will be held downtown Thursday, May 8, from 5:30 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. in the Townsite Avenue Ballroom. At the awards ceremony, attendees will hear about the impact and successes of the community’s thriving small-business scene, and they’ll learn which finalists rose to the top of their respective categories to receive awards.
Awards will be presented in the following categories, with the 2025 Top City Small Business of the Year being selected from among category winners: Micro Enterprise Award, Woman-Owned Small Business Award, Minority-Owned Small Business Award, Veteran-Owned Small Business Award, Legacy in Business Award, and Small Business Manufacturer Award.
“We’re honored to recognize the incredible small businesses and entrepreneurs who drive innovation and growth in Topeka and Shawnee County,” said Stephanie Norwood, director of entrepreneurship and small business for GO Topeka. “This year’s 18 finalists showcase the passion, creativity, and determination that make our business community so strong. We look forward to celebrating their achievements and making this year’s Small Business Awards a truly special event. Congratulations to all!”

To be eligible for an award, small businesses had to be nominated, located within Shawnee County, and maintain 100 or fewer employees, including the owner(s). Evaluation included review of each business’s vision, staying power, growth, innovativeness, response to adversity, and community engagement.
